The View: A Platform of Diverse Perspectives

The View, a long-running American talk show, is renowned for its panel of female co-hosts who discuss current events, political issues, and pop culture. What makes The View unique, and often controversial, is its deliberate attempt to present a range of perspectives on hot-button topics. The show's format, where hosts often disagree passionately, is designed to spark conversation and reflect the broader spectrum of opinions present in society.
